Missouri vs Colorado State odds preview: Midwest betting Odds Preview
OddsShark Staff - Missouri takes on Colorado State Thursday, as betting in the Midwest Region tips off.
This game, at Rupp Arena, pits the No. 8 Tigers in their first season of SEC play, against the Rams of the Mountain West. Colorado State is just 2-8-1 ATS in its past 11 games and has been a solid OVER play lately at 6-0-1.The 25-8 Rams count on Colton Iverson. They did not have a single win over a Top 25 team this season. Missouri (23-10) meanwhile beat Illinois and Florida and count on Laurence Bowers (forward) and Jabari Brown (guard) for their scoring.
The Tigers will try to spoil to the party on Thursday; they are 14-15 ATS against the number this season, while the Rams are 13-14-2 ATS. Missouri is 16-12 on the totals; Colorado State is 12-12-1.
